fixed temperature heat detectors are an integral part of any fire alarm system, often working alongside smoke detectors to provide comprehensive coverage. While smoke detectors are effective at detecting the presence of smoke particles in the air, they may not always be the best choice for certain environments. For example, smoke detectors may be prone to false alarms in areas with high levels of dust or steam, which can compromise their reliability.

In contrast, fixed temperature heat detectors are specifically designed to respond to increases in temperature, making them ideal for environments where smoke detection may not be practical. These detectors are typically set to trigger an alarm when the temperature reaches a pre-determined threshold, signaling the presence of a fire before smoke becomes visible. This early warning allows occupants to evacuate the building safely and gives firefighters a head start in extinguishing the fire before it spreads.

One of the key benefits of fixed temperature heat detectors is their simplicity and reliability. Unlike more complex fire detection systems, such as smoke detectors that require periodic maintenance and cleaning, fixed temperature detectors are low-maintenance devices that are less prone to false alarms. This makes them a cost-effective and dependable option for a wide range of environments, from industrial facilities to residential buildings.

fixed temperature heat detectors are also highly versatile and can be used in a variety of settings to ensure comprehensive fire protection. They are often installed in areas where smoke detectors may not be suitable, such as kitchens, garages, and mechanical rooms.
